Journey to Mount Pilatus: Cogwheel and Aerial Cableway
From Alpnachstad, your adventure continues aboard the world’s steepest cogwheel railway, which climbs sharply into the mountains. This train ride alone is worth the trip—climbing from 700 meters to 2,073 meters, the engine pulls you through lush forests and rocky terrain, offering close-up views of the Alpine flora and geological formations. Several visitors mention the thrill and uniqueness of this ride, with one noting, “The cogwheel train is a must-do; the engine’s climb is so steep, it feels like you’re on a roller coaster.”
Upon reaching the mountain station, you’ll have options to explore. Many guests enjoy a leisurely lunch at the mountain restaurant, marveling at the panoramic vistas. The summit offers eye-popping views over Lucerne, its lakes, and distant peaks—ideal for photography or just soaking in the tranquillity.

The Iconic Dragon Cable Car Ride
Descending from the mountain, you’ll experience the famous dragon aerial cable car—a giant glass cabin offering 360-degree views. Many describe this as one of the most memorable parts of the trip, comparing it to flying due to the panoramic windows and the sense of floating over the landscape. It’s a gentle, scenic way to return to the valley, with views that change as you descend.
